Complete Buying Guide for RV Black Water Totes
Essential Factors We Consider
When choosing an RV black water tote, focus on these critical aspects:
- Capacity – Match your typical dump frequency (15-32 gallons covers most needs)
- Material – Look for high-density polyethylene (HDPE) or LLDPE for durability
- Mobility – Dual wheels > single wheels for easier movement
- Odor Control – Vent direction matters when dumping
- Weight – Lightweight options are easier to handle
Budget Planning
Totes range from $40-$200+ depending on capacity and features. Here’s a quick guide:
- $40-$80: Basic single-wheel models (good for occasional use)
- $80-$150: Premium dual-wheel options (best balance of features)
- $150+: Large-capacity professional-grade totes

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How often should I empty my RV black water tank?
A: Empty when ¾ full to prevent overflow and maintain proper function. Most RVs need daily dumping, but large-capacity totes can go 2-3 days between uses.
Q: Can I use a regular trash can as a black water tote?
A: No, standard cans lack the durability and odor control needed for sewage waste. Use only dedicated black water totes designed for this purpose.
Q: What’s the difference between gray and black water tanks?
A: Black water contains human waste and needs specialized handling. Gray water (from sinks/shower) doesn’t require dedicated totes but should still be contained properly.
Q: Do black water totes come with handles?
A: Many include handles, but always verify before purchase. Some models rely on wheels instead.
Q: How do I clean my black water tote after each use?
A: Rinse with hot soapy water immediately after use. Periodic deep cleaning with a mild bleach solution prevents odors.
